Perry Mason, enlisted by Edward Garvin, finds himself embroiled in a complex divorce scandal that escalates dramatically when Garvin’s ex-wife is murdered. This narrative trajectory guarantees a rollercoaster of emotions as Mason navigates through a treacherous landscape of motives and alibis. The legal intricacies are tightly interwoven with personal drama, presenting a rich tapestry of events that keep readers guessing until the very end. Each chapter is packed with unexpected twists that echo the tradition of classic whodunits, appealing to both longtime fans and newcomers to the genre.

In comparison with other legal thrillers and detective novels, the Perry Mason series stands out not only for its historical significance but also for its rich character development. Unlike many contemporary legal dramas that often focus on procedural elements, Gardner’s narrative style leans heavily towards character arcs and moral quandaries, creating an immersive experience that resonates on various levels. Additionally, the renewed interest in Mason due to the current HBO series showcases the timeless allure of the narrative and its characters, reinforcing Mason’s place in literary history.
